Swiss VAT: rates, threshold and filings

Registration happens with the Federal Tax Administration and yields a VAT number based on the business identifier (format CHE-xxx.xxx.xxx VAT). From then on, every invoice must state that number, the rate applied and the tax amount — three details SA incorporation should lock down from day one to avoid retroactive fixes.

Also useful for SA incorporation: some supplies are excluded from VAT (health, education, property rental) — with no corresponding input VAT right. Qualifying revenues correctly from the start avoids surprises.

Effective VAT method or net tax rate: how to choose?

The effective method deducts actual input VAT and files quarterly; the net tax rate method applies a flat industry rate to turnover, semi-annually, with no separate input VAT deduction. The flat rate suits low-cost structures; as investments grow, the effective method usually wins again. The choice rests on the company's own figures, in Givisiez as anywhere.

What is the difference between a limited and an ordinary audit?

The ordinary audit applies to companies exceeding, for two consecutive years, two of three thresholds: CHF 20 million balance sheet total, CHF 40 million revenue, 250 full-time positions. Others fall under the limited audit, and those with no more than ten full-time positions on annual average can opt out with all shareholders' consent. These federal thresholds do not depend on the registered seat — in Givisiez as anywhere.
